Hey — quick handover before I'm out. The Lumenpay integration suite is still flaky: the refund-flow tests fail maybe one in five runs, always on the ledger reconciliation step. I suspect the mock settlement service races the webhook listener. I've quarantined the worst three specs and left notes in the test harness. Don't merge anything touching settlement until it's green twice in a row. The person who owns fixing this is listed below.

account owner for fajep-yagef: Kasix Eliiel

The `/v2/agents/heartbeat` endpoint accepts a `reported_time` field so the Fernwheel coordinator can measure drift across build agents. Reviewers should note that skew beyond 800ms causes artifact timestamps to be rejected, so the coordinator now applies a signed offset rather than trusting agent clocks. All heartbeat calls must be authenticated; unauthenticated drift reports are discarded silently. When exercising this endpoint in the review sandbox, include the bearer token shown below in the Authorization header.

login token, bagug-kafop: eyJhbGciOiJIUzI1NiIsInR5cCI6IkpXVCJ9.eyJzdWIiOiIcMLov2In0.Z5RLDIfp

- [ ] Step 7: Verify the Sievegate bloom filter fronting the Cairnstore key-value cluster was rebuilt from the sealed snapshot, not live traffic. Confirm the false-positive rate matches the ceremony manifest. Both ceremony officers must witness the rebuild. Unsealing the snapshot volume requires the quorum recovery passphrase, transcribed for this ceremony immediately below.

unlock words, hahip-yagef: zorok-novmir-zorix-silax

## Migration Step 4 — Password Reset Flow Cutover (Heronlock v3)

For this week's sync: before enabling the new token-based reset flow, backfill the legacy reset_requests rows into the new token table. Run the backfill script in dry-run mode first and confirm row counts match within 0.1%. Old links remain valid for 72 hours post-cutover. The backfill job reads from the legacy store using the connection string below.

primary connection of yagep-kahip = redis://giliel_svc:zYiKsLL2PLpfPL@db-348f.xolmarsys.corp:5432/fenwyn